Each HDF5 dataset contains triplets of fields: -7_8mdm001R_dt_015 contains "Density", "Dark_Matter_Density" and "Temperature" (a 512^3 grid for each); -7_8mdm001R_v_015 contains "x-velocity", "y-velocity" and "z-velocity" gas velocity fields (a 512^3 grid for each); -7_8mdm001R_b_015 contains "Bx", "By" and "Bz" - the components of the magnetic field (a 512^3 grid for each). All values must be multiplied by the following conversion factors in order to get them in CGS units, given in the corresponding conv2 files, in which the 3rd entry is the redshift (z), the 4th (convd) entry gives the conversion
to have Density and Dark_Matter_Density in g/cm^3; while the 5th entry (convv) gives the conversion for velocity components in cm/s; -convb=sqrt(convd4pi)convv*(1+z)^2. to have the magnetic field components in Gauss. The comoving cell resolution is 7.9 kpc/cell. The model started from a uniform seed magnetic field of 0.1nG (comoving). Cosmological AMR simulations performed with the ENZO code, using the Dedner MHD method.
